513 Kush

OG Kush × Hindu Kush × Bubba Kush × Triangle Kush × Chem

513 Kush is a notable hybrid strain celebrated for its deeply relaxing and euphoric effects, originating from the Midwestern United States. It is recognized for its dense, trichome-rich flowers and a complex aromatic profile that blends earthy, citrus, and fuel-like notes.

Appearance

Mature 513 Kush flowers are characterized by their dense structure, heavy calyxes, and tightly stacked bracts, resulting in minimal leafiness. The buds often display a dual-tone green coloration, with lime-green bracts contrasting against deeper forest-green sugar leaves. Occasional lavender hues may appear when the plant is flowered under cooler temperatures. A dense covering of trichomes gives the buds a glossy, almost wet appearance, with orange to light-copper pistils interspersed throughout.

Aroma & Flavor

The aroma of 513 Kush is a layered bouquet featuring earthy and citrus notes, often with a distinct fuel-like or diesel edge. Initial grinding releases scents of damp soil, pine, and sweet citrus, with prominent lemon and orange oil undertones. Upon combustion or vaping, the flavor profile includes sweet lemon zest, pine resin, and floral lavender on the inhale, transitioning to peppered earth and fuel notes on the exhale. A lingering savory-lime aftertaste is commonly reported.

Effects

Users typically experience a rapid onset of effects, beginning with a mentally clearing lift within minutes, followed by a profound sense of physical ease. The mental state is often described as calm and confident, with mood elevation and increased sociability. While initially energizing for some, the experience generally settles into a serene, heavy-lidded relaxation within one to one-and-a-half hours, with effects lasting for two to four hours.

Terpenes & Cannabinoids

513 Kush is a THC-dominant strain, typically testing between 22-25% THC, with minimal CBD content. The terpene profile is primarily driven by Myrcene, Limonene, and Caryophyllene, contributing to its distinct aroma and effects. Secondary terpenes like Humulene and Linalool may also be present, adding herbal and floral nuances. Minor cannabinoids such as CBG are usually detected in low percentages.

Origins & Lineage

The name "513" likely refers to the telephone area code for Cincinnati, Ohio, suggesting a regional origin or breeder homage. While precise parentage is unverified, it is widely believed to be a descendant of the Kush family, possibly an OG Kush variant. Hypotheses suggest it may have been backcrossed to a Hindu Kush or Bubba-type strain to enhance its resin production and compact structure, or crossed with a Triangle Kush or Chem-leaning male to intensify its gas and citrus characteristics.
